复合锂基脂的制备工艺研究  被引量:1

摘  要:本文探讨了加水量、酸的组成、最高炼制温度及剪切时间对复合锂基润滑脂性能的影响。结果表明,当加水量为碱量的两倍,12-羟基硬脂酸与癸二酸的物质的量比为0.5,最高炼制温度为210℃,剪切时间为15min的润滑脂性能优异、能耗低、生产效率高。The production formula, condition and technology of preparing lithium complex grease had been comprehensively discussed in this paper. The study shows that the optimum process is that the water addition is two times of the alkali, the molar ratio of 12 - hydroxystearic acid to sebaeic acid is at best 0.5, the highest refining temperature is 210 ℃ and the shearing process time for 15minutes, the grease has the advantages of excellent performance, low energy consumption and high efficiency.
